New Leader Takes Reins At Rainbow Riding Center In Prince William County

Maddie Gierber will lead the Haymarket nonprofit, which provides equine-assisted programs to more than 300 students each year.

HAYMARKET, VA — Maddie Gierber has been named executive director of Rainbow Therapeutic Riding Center, a Haymarket nonprofit serving children and adults through equine-assisted programs, InsideNoVa reported.

Gierber joined the organization as a weekend barn manager in 2012 and became program director in 2024. She will oversee 10 employees, 10 therapy horses and programs serving more than 300 Northern Virginia students and their families each year, according to the report.

Gierber succeeds Inga Janke, who led the center for 11 years as it expanded from about 1,000 lessons annually to more than 3,000. Janke will remain with the organization in an advisory role through the end of 2026.
